        Long Noncoding RNA MALAT1 Regulates Hepatocellular Carcinoma Growth Under Hypoxia via Sponging MicroRNA-200a

        Zheng-Bin Zhao,Fei Chen,Xiao-Fang Bai 연세대학교의과대학 2019 Yonsei medical journal Vol.60 No.8

        Purpose: Hepatocellular carcinoma (HCC) is a common cancer worldwide. Metastasis-associated lung adenocarcinoma transcript1 (MALAT1), a long noncoding RNA (lncRNA), has been reported to be aberrantly expressed in hypoxic cancer cells. MALAT1 playsa significant role in many malignancies, including HCC. The aim of this study was to explore the role of MALAT1 in hypoxic HCCcells and its underlying regulatory mechanism. Materials and Methods: Quantitative reverse transcription PCR (qRT-PCR) assay was performed to detect the mRNA levels ofMALAT1 and microRNA-200a (miR-200a) in HCC cells. Cell invasion and migration ability were evaluated by Transwell assay. Starbasev2.0 and luciferase reporter assay were employed to identify the association between MALAT1 and miR-200a. Cell proliferationand apoptosis were measured by MTT assay and flow cytometry, respectively. Results: MALAT1 levels were significantly upregulated in HCC cells under hypoxia. Hypoxia promoted proliferation, migration,and invasion, and blocked apoptosis in Hep3B cells, which were weakened by knockdown of MALAT1. Starbase v2.0 showed thatMALAT1 and miR-200a have a complementarity region, and luciferase reporter assay verified that MALAT1 interacted with miR-200a in Hep3B cells. Moreover, MALAT1 negatively regulated the expression of miR-200a. miR-200a levels were dramatically downregulatedin HCC cells under hypoxia. Upregulation of miR-200a inhibited proliferation, migration, and invasion, and inducedapoptosis in Hep3B cells under hypoxia. Interestingly, downregulation of miR-200a partially reversed the tumor-suppressive effectof knockdown of MALAT1 on Hep3B cells in hypoxic condition. Conclusion: LncRNA MALAT1 was involved in proliferation, migration, invasion, and apoptosis by interacting with miR-200a inhypoxic Hep3B cells, revealing a new mechanism of MALAT1 involved in hypoxic HCC progression.

      • Characteristics of Mammary Paget's Disease in China: a National-wide Multicenter Retrospective Study During 1999-2008

        Zheng, Shan,Song, Qing-Kun,Zhao, Lin,Huang, Rong,Sun, Li,Li, Jing,Fan, Jin-Hu,Zhang, Bao-Ning,Yang, Hong-Jian,Xu, Feng,Zhang, Bin,Qiao, You-Lin Asian Pacific Journal of Cancer Prevention 2012 Asian Pacific journal of cancer prevention Vol.13 No.5

        The aim of this study was to detail characteristics of mammary Paget's disease (PD) representing the whole population in China. A total of 4211 female breast cancer inpatients at seven tertiary hospitals from seven representative geographical regions of China were collected randomly during 1999 to 2008. Data for demography, risk factors, diagnostic imaging test, physical examination and pathologic characters were surveyed and biomarker status was tested by immunohistochemistry. The differences of demography and risk factors between PD with breast cancer and other lesions were compared using Chi-square test or t-test, with attention to physical examination and pathological characters. The percentage of PD was 1.6% (68/4211) in all breast cancers. The mean age at diagnosis was 48.1, and 63.2% (43/68) patients were premenopausal. There is no difference in demography and risk factors between PD with breast cancer and other breast cancer (P > 0.05). The main pattern of PD in physical exam and pathologic pattern were patients presenting with a palpable mass in breast (65/68, 95.6%) and PD with underlying invasive cancer (82.4%, 56/68) respectively. The rate of multifocal disease was 7.4% (5/68). PD with invasive breast cancer showed larger tumor size, more multifocal disease, lower ER and PR expression and higher HER2 overexpression than those in other invasive breast cancer (P < 0.05). These results suggested that PD in China is a concomitant disease of breast cancer, and that PD with underlying invasive cancer has more multiple foci and more aggressive behavior compared with other breast invasive cancer. We address the urgent needs for establishing diagnostic and therapeutic guidelines for mammary PD in China.

        The Efficacy of Saccharomyces boulardii CNCM I-745 in Addition to Standard Helicobacter pylori Eradication Treatment in Children

        Zhang, Bin,Xu, Ya-Zheng,Deng, Zhao-Hui,Chu, Bo,Jiang, Li-Rong,Vandenplas, Yvan The Korean Society of Pediatric Gastroenterology 2015 Pediatric gastroenterology, hepatology & nutrition Vol.18 No.1

        Purpose: This study aims to investigate Saccharomyces boulardii CNCM I-745 during Helicobacter pylori eradication in children. Methods: One hundred ninety-four H. pylori positive children were randomized in two groups. Therapy (omeprazole+ clarithromycin+amoxicillin or omeprazole+clarithromycin+metronidazole in case of penicillin allergy) was given to both groups during two weeks. In the treatment group (n: 102) S. boulardii was added to the triple therapy, while the control group (n: 92) only received triple therapy. The incidence, onset, duration and severity of diarrhea and compliance to the eradication treatment were compared. A $^{13}C$ urea breath test was done 4 weeks after the end of eradication therapy in two groups of 21 patients aged 12 years and older to test the H. pylori eradication rate. Results: In the treatment group, diarrhea occurred in 12 cases (11.76%), starting after $6.25{\pm}1.24days$, lasting $3.17{\pm}1.08days$, and compliance to eradication treatment was 100%. In the control group, diarrhea occurred in 26 cases (28.26%), starting after $4.05{\pm}1.11days$, lasting $4.02{\pm}0.87days$, and in six cases eradication treatment was stopped prematurely (p<0.05). The $^{13}C$ urea breath test showed successful H. pylori eradication in 71.4% of the patients in the treatment and in 61.9 % in the control group (not significant). Conclusion: S. boulardii has a beneficial effect on the prevention and treatment of diarrhea during H. pylori eradication in children. Although S. boulardii did only slightly increase H. pylori eradication rate, compliance to eradication treatment was improved.

        Effects of Reynolds number on the flow field in a low-pressure turbine with incoming wakes

        Xu Zhao,Yunfei Wang,Xiaozhong Ma,Yaowen Zhang,Long Yue,Bin Zheng 대한기계학회 2023 JOURNAL OF MECHANICAL SCIENCE AND TECHNOLOGY Vol.37 No.11

        In order to further understand the effects of the Reynolds number on the flow field within a low-pressure turbine with incoming wakes, the transition SST turbulence model was employed for numerical simulation under four Reynolds number conditions ranging from 0.6×10 5 to 3.0×10 5 . The numerical results showed that the boundary layer separation at the rear part of the suction surface was prone to occur in the condition of low Reynolds number (Re 2th = 0.6×10 5 ), and the separation bubble was semi-open and semi-closed. The separation bubble impedes the development of the passage vortex and wall vortex towards mid-span region. When the Reynolds number exceeds 1.0×10 5 , boundary layer separation does not occur. The influence of Reynolds number on the total pressure loss coefficient is primarily evident on the suction surface side, and the growth rate of total pressure loss coefficient first increases and then decreases along the streamwise direction. As the Reynolds number increases from 0.6×10 5 to 3.0×10 5 , the peak point location of total pressure loss decreases by approximately 12 %. The influence of Reynolds number on corner vortex and wall vortex is relatively more sensitive compared to that of passage vortex.

      • The Effect of New Ecological Paradigm on Pro-Environmental Behaviors: Mediating Role of Environmental Attitudes

        Kai-bin Zhao,Zheng Jin,Timothy Tamunang Tamutana,Yi-Ming Shi,Marina Kogay,Hanna Yeshinegus Adamseged 한국공공가치학회 2021 공공가치연구 Vol.1 No.1

        Acquiring a better understanding of what drives pro-environmental behaviors is important for human. This study explores the underlying mechanism between New Ecological Paradigm and pro-environmental behaviors. Based on cognitive dissonance theory and identity theory, a questionnaire, including New Ecological Paradigm scale, pro-environmental attitude scale and pro-environmental behaviors scales, was used to investigate 1352 university students. The results indicated that: (1) There were significant correlations among New Ecological Paradigm, pro-environmental attitude and pro-environmental behaviors; (2) pro-environmental attitude played mediating role between New Ecological Paradigm and pro-environmental behaviors. In summary, this study uncovered the mechanism underlying the relationship between New Ecological Paradigm and pro-environmental behaviors, which contributes to the understanding of the complex mechanism that influence people s pro-environmental behaviors.

        Resonant Frequency Estimation of Reradiation Interference at MF from Power Transmission Lines Based on Generalized Resonance Theory

        Bo, Tang,Bin, Chen,Zhibin, Zhao,Zheng, Xiao,Shuang, Wang The Korean Institute of Electrical Engineers 2015 Journal of Electrical Engineering & Technology Vol.10 No.3

        The resonant mechanism of reradiation interference (RRI) over 1.7MHz from power transmission lines cannot be obtained from IEEE standards, which are based on researches of field intensity. Hence, the resonance is ignored in National Standards of protecting distance between UHV power lines and radio stations in China, which would result in an excessive redundancy of protecting distance. Therefore, based on the generalized resonance theory, we proposed the idea of applying model-based parameter estimation (MBPE) to estimate the generalized resonance frequency of electrically large scattering objects. We also deduced equation expressions of the generalized resonance frequency and its quality factor Q in a lossy open electromagnetic system, i.e. an antenna-transmission line system in this paper. Taking the frequency band studied by IEEE and the frequency band over 1.7 MHz as object, we established three models of the RRI from transmission lines, namely the simplified line model, the tower line model considering cross arms and the line-surface mixed model. With the models, we calculated the scattering field of sampling points with equal intervals using method of moments, and then inferred expressions of Padé rational function. After calculating the zero-pole points of the Padé rational function, we eventually got the estimation of the RRI’s generalized resonant frequency. Our case studies indicate that the proposed estimation method is effective for predicting the generalized resonant frequency of RRI in medium frequency (MF, 0.3~3 MHz) band over 1.7 MHz, which expands the frequency band studied by IEEE.

        Metagenomic and Proteomic Analyses of a Mangrove Microbial Community Following Green Macroalgae Enteromorpha prolifera Degradation

        ( Yijing Wu ),( Chao Zhao ),( Zheng Xiao ),( Hetong Lin ),( Lingwei Ruan ),( Bin Liu ) 한국미생물 · 생명공학회 2016 Journal of microbiology and biotechnology Vol.26 No.12

        A mangrove microbial community was analyzed at the gene and protein levels using metagenomic and proteomic methods with the green macroalgae Enteromorpha prolifera as the substrate. Total DNA was sequenced on the Illumina HiSeq 2000 PE-100 platform. Twodimensional gel electrophoresis in combination with liquid chromatography tandem mass spectrometry was used for proteomic analysis. The metagenomic data revealed that the orders Pseudomonadales, Rhizobiales, and Sphingomonadales were the most prevalent in the mangrove microbial community. By monitoring changes at the functional level, proteomic analyses detected ATP synthase and transporter proteins, which were expressed mainly by members of the phyla Proteobacteria and Bacteroidetes. Members of the phylum Proteobacteria expressed a high number of sugar transporters and demonstrated specialized and efficient digestion of various glycans. A few glycoside hydrolases were detected in members of the phylum Firmicutes, which appeared to be the main cellulose-degrading bacteria. This is the first report of multiple “omics” analysis of E. prolifera degradation. These results support the fact that key enzymes of glycoside hydrolase family were expressed in large quantities, indicating the high metabolic activity of the community.

        Patent Ductus Arteriosus and Pulmonary Valve Stenosis in A Patient with 18p Deletion Syndrome

        Chun-Hong Xie,Jian-Bin Yang,Fang-Qi Gong,Zheng-Yan Zhao 연세대학교의과대학 2008 Yonsei medical journal Vol.49 No.3

        We report on a patient with a partial deletion on the short arm of chromosome 18 (del 18p), who presented with dysmorphic features and delayed developmental milestones as well as with a patent ductus arteriosus (PDA) and pulmonary valve stenosis (PS). Several forms of congenital heart disease (CHD) are found in about 10% of patients with del (18p), but coexisting PDA and PS have not been reported. Del (18p) must be considered in patients with characteristic phenotypic abnormalities and congenital heart disease, including a combination of PDA and PS.
